External Agency Fund: YES! Youth Services

 

The YES!, Youth Engagement Services, division of the Office for Safe and Healthy Neighborhoods, works to create a network of groups and services that literally transform social and government systems that systematically repress the diverse youth voice and their rights to live equitably. Grants for community efforts for violence prevention and reduction help to ensure the health, well-being and voice inclusion of all youths in Louisville and Jefferson County and promotes a youth’s development of good character and citizenship.

All grantees will be regularly monitored for program effectiveness and are expected to submit routine reports.

A virtual orientation was held by Webex on January 17, 2023 for agencies wishing to apply which provided information about deadlines, how to access the application and other general information.

The External Agency Fund consists of our division, Arts External Agency Fund, and Community Services External Agency Fund.
